Weather in March

Weather in Fuengirola in March signals the transition from winter to spring. The average high temperature increases to 16.3°C (61.3°F) and rainfall frequency meets the high mark seen in January, at about 15mm (0.59") spread over nearly 7 days. The sunlight extends, providing longer hours for everyone embracing outdoor activities. The increased daylight, together with the stable cloud cover and humidity, sets the scene for pleasant weather conditions. Winds remain quite steady in their pace compared to February, keeping the weather refreshingly brisk.

Temperature

March observes an average high-temperature of a still refreshing 16.3°C (61.3°F), marking an insignificant difference from February's 15°C (59°F). A mean low-temperature of 11.9°C (53.4°F) is anticipated during the month of March in Fuengirola, Spain, a slight step down from the daytime high.

Humidity

The months with the highest humidity in Fuengirola are March, April and December, with an average relative humidity of 72%.

Rainfall

In Fuengirola, in March, during 6.8 rainfall days, 15mm (0.59") of precipitation is typically accumulated. Throughout the year, there are 52.5 rainfall days, and 113mm (4.45") of precipitation is accumulated.

Sea temperature

February and March, with an average sea temperature of 15°C (59°F), are months with the coldest seawater in Fuengirola.
Note: Most individuals do not find swimming at 15°C (59°F) to be enjoyable. As the water temperature declines below 21°C (69.8°F), maintaining control over one's breathing becomes harder.

Daylight

In March, the average length of the day is 11h and 59min.
On the first day of March in Fuengirola, sunrise is at 07:48 and sunset at 19:13. On the last day of the month, sunrise is at 07:04 and sunset at 19:40 CET.

Sunshine

In Fuengirola, the average sunshine in March is 8.6h.

UV index

January through March, November and December, with an average maximum UV index of 4, are months with the lowest UV index in Fuengirola, Spain. A UV Index of 3 to 5 symbolizes a moderate health risk from exposure to the Sun's UV radiation for the ordinary person.
Note: The maximum daily UV index, 4 in March, converts into the following recommendations:
Undertake protective steps - Obligation to safeguard skin and eyes from harm is in place. To guard against the harmful effects of the Sun, minimize exposure during midday. Equip yourself with UVA and UVB-filtering sunglasses on clear, sunny days.
